Bolivia - Medium and high tech exports
Medium and high-tech exports (% manufactured exports)
The value for Medium and high-tech exports (% manufactured exports) in Bolivia was 4.60 as of 2019. As the graph below shows, over the past 29 years this indicator reached a maximum value of 40.11 in 1999 and a minimum value of 1.94 in 2017.
Definition: Share of medium and high-tech manufactured exports in total manufactured exports.
Source: United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O), Competitive Industrial Performance (CIP) database
